Abstract
The present invention provides a kind of accurate assembled master mold of standardization box module and construction technologies, assembled master mold includes the first module, second module, third module, 4th module and expansion resetting apparatus, first module and second modular spacing are simultaneously symmetrical arranged, the third module and the 4th modular spacing are located on the inside of the top of first module and second module and on the inside of lower section, the assembled master mold frame of square structure is consequently formed, side of second module far from first module is symmetrical above and below to be equipped with one group of expansion resetting apparatus, 4th module is equipped with another group of expansion resetting apparatus far from the side bilateral symmetry of the third module.

Technical field
The present invention relates to piping lane technical field of construction, in particular to the accurate assembled master mold of a kind of standardization box module and apply
Work technique.
Background technique
Currently, usually first making assembled master mold, the assembly of internal model is then carried out in the inside of assembled master mold.However, existing
Assembled master mold is usually all fixed structure, there is the disadvantages of being not easy to adjust, is inconvenient to use.
